BP PLC has started production from the second stage of its West Nile Delta development offshore Egypt. The project, which produces gas from Giza and Fayoum fields, was developed as a deepwater, long-distance tie-back to an existing onshore plant. The Giza and Fayoum development, which includes eight wells, is producing 400 MMcfd of gas and is expected to ramp up to a maximum rate of some 700 MMcfd.
